I'll do my best.

Capabilities are endless when you talk about different machines with different wave lengths. The lasers I program are mainly marking (etching) lasers, but we also have a cutting laser. The materials we mainly mark are stainless steel & aluminum, parts are usually anodized black (the laser turns the black anodize white, gives it a nice contrast). The machines we use are quite big, Probably 6' wide x 6' deep x 8' tall. I can get you the voltage on Monday. Operating costs aren't too bad. The company Rofin sells warranties with their machines, and you can schedule someone to come every 6 months to perform preventative maintenance. The lasers we bought were in the $150,000 range. We clamp some parts (and fixture others), but most parts are just benched against 2 rails (in the shape of a L), so we have a good 0 location when programming parts.
